用Python制作游戏的处理顺序一般是先准备开发环境,再搭建游戏框架,接着实现核心逻辑,最后进行测试优化。首个关键控制点在于安装必要库并验证初始化是否成功,否则后续渲染和事件处理都无法正常进行。落地时,先确认Python版本兼容,再执行安装命令,避免环境冲突。
常见流程结构包括导入模块、设置游戏窗口、编写主循环以及处理用户输入。在生产制造类产品研发中,这类似从原料准备到加工组装的环节。关键步骤之一是定义精灵或对象管理机制,用于控制游戏元素移动和交互。
Python游戏制作关键步骤与控制重点
| 步骤阶段 | 主要操作 | 常见风险 |
|---|---|---|
| 环境准备 | 安装库并初始化 | 版本不兼容导致启动失败 |
| 框架搭建 | 创建窗口和主循环 | 循环未正确退出引起卡顿 |
| 逻辑实现 | 处理事件和碰撞检测 | 边界判断缺失导致元素越界 |
| 优化测试 | 添加音效和性能调整 | 资源加载过多影响运行流畅度 |
以上步骤需按顺序执行,每个阶段完成后进行简单复核。
控制重点在于事件处理和画面更新环节。执行时,先获取输入状态,再更新对象位置,最后渲染画面。复核标准是尽量每帧刷新率稳定,避免画面撕裂。在企业经营场景中,这对应工艺流程中的质量把控点。
常见失误包括忽略边界检查导致程序崩溃,或资源文件路径错误影响加载。采购或选型类似环节时,建议提前准备素材规格,尽量兼容主流格式。加工过程中,注意代码模块化以便后续维护。
整体操作中,供应链思维有助于控制成本,例如选择轻量库减少开发资源投入。通过以上流程,企业或开发者能有序推进游戏制作项目。